After a certain point in the games main story, Yuni and Mihara, get drawn into a conflict inside of the ark which is primarily Yuni's fault even if she was being manipulated by Crow at the time. After she was stopped Mihara was again subjected to a mind swipe. Yuni however suffered a fate worse than death or even a mind swipe, they turned her into an experiment integrating her body with rapture parts mutating her severely and breaking her mind, her body is mostly covered by a cloak and a mask covers her face so we can't see what they turned her into. She's barely capable of saying more than a few words as she's reduced to a mindless robot only capable of following orders. Truly tragic, she likely had it coming with the stunt she pulled but it was an understandable crash out to some extent.

You’ve got a couple points wrong. Yuni’s mind isn’t broken, her inner dialogue shows that she’s perfectly capable of thinking clearly, even if she does still think childishly. So, not mindless either. She is, however, completely incapable of coherent speech and is only able to make select sounds, hence the Wordless side story. It’s not that she’s only capable of acting on orders, she still has to listen to orders the same as any other Nikke and can make decisions on her own when not under orders, but she also suffers from the influence of the Rapture core implanted inside her.
